Cowboys | Phillips may add son to coaching staff
Sat, 10 Feb 2007

Clarence E. Hill Jr., of the Forth Worth Star-Telegram, reports Dallas Cowboys head coach Wade Phillips said he may add his son, Wes Phillips, to the team's coaching staff. Wes is the quarterbacks coach at Baylor University. Wade Phillips said, "It's a possibility. Actually, San Diego and Cleveland, he's interviewing with both of those teams. We might have to hurry to get him."

Phillips best of a bad lot


If your choices are Norv Turner, Ron Rivera and Wade Phillips, Phillips is probably the best of a terrible lot. Turner brings nothing but ineptitude to the job. He had less success as a former head coach then Wade Phillips did. Ron Rivera is terrible. I'm confused by what his supporters see in him. He made no adjustments in the Super Bowl. That vaunted Bears' defense is as much the product of a piss-poor schedules the last two years, as it is anything else The Bears' defense, as overrated as it was, wasn't Rivera's baby, so he can't claim much credit for it. Putting Rivera in charge of a 3-4 defense makes no sense from a tactical point of view, Phillips was probably the correct hire, but ultimately still a bad one. Hiring a fresh face for the sake of avoiding a retread isn't always a smart move, especially is the fresh faces are as uninspiring as the retreads. Needless to say, the Cowboys will not win anything in the foreseeable future.
